In addition to being conventional skin specialists, today's dermatologists also practice as dermatologic surgeons and cosmetologists. Cosmetic operations are becoming increasingly popular. Cosmetic operations carry the danger of malpractice lawsuits, which could result in a dissatisfied patient and a time-consuming lawsuit against the doctor. As the legislation differs greatly in different parts of the world, developing a law for the entire world is nearly difficult. The dermatologist should be informed of local legislation governing clinic dimensions and basic standards for specialized clinics.
